Ethical Wedding Attire For Eco Acutely Aware Brides
What better time to celebrate the values that matter most to you than in your wedding ceremony day? According to our 2021 Newlywed Report, 20% of couples reported incorporating sustainable elements into their weddings in 2020, from utilizing recycled paper to creating extra eco-friendly food selections. Buying a sustainable wedding costume is another nice method to plan a more eco-conscious celebration—and it is a lot easier than you may assume. The label was born of a desire to scale back waste and create lasting optimistic change in the style industry by producing couture bridal designs that don’t compromise on integrity. The gowns are all about simplicity and elegance with substance and entice brides who love great design, individuality and sustainability.
This made-to-order practice minimizes overproduction, surplus, and waste compared to different mass produced kinds. Sustainability is a steady journey and we are always attempting to improve, 100% eco friendly robes are still a challenge.
